Caption: "Guard Mount. Presidio," c. 1906, shows two groups of men in formation on the Presidio grounds. One group of men is playing musical instruments, while the other group is carrying firearms. Established in 1776 by Spanish explorers, the Presidio is a fortified location overlooking the Golden Gate, the entrance into San Francisco Bay. It was closed as a military structure in 1995, and is now a park within the Golden Gate National Recreation Area.
